Stress Engineer - Structural Repair Manual (SRM)

full-timePosted: Jan 6, 2026

Job Description

Job Description:

We analyze aircraft structure, create generic repair procedures, perform stress analysis and publish Structure Repair Manual (SRM) documentation for the Nose and Center Fuselage as well as Powerplant and Wings for all AIRBUS standards. Our team specializes in the Structural Repair Manual (SRM), a crucial document enabling airlines to dispatch and repair aircraft.

This role primarily involves developing stress justifications for structural repair solutions. You will also be responsible for coordination with various Airbus divisions and subcontracting partners, and for contributing to the development of generic structural repair solutions.
 

Required Skills & Expertise:
Strong foundation in structural design and/or stress analysis, including Fatigue & Damage Tolerance (F&DT).
A minimum of 6 years experience in stress analysis (Static / Fatigue / Damage Tolerance) for aircraft metallic or composite structures (development, repair, or production support roles preferred).
Familiarity with stress tools (analytical or FEM) is preferred.
Knowledge of AIRBUS tools & manuals (e.g., ISAMI, ISAMI Xpress, SRM, NTM) will be an added advantage.

Proven ability to analyze and validate Metal &/or Composites / Hybrids structures at component level for static strength, F&DT and produce relevant strength margins or reserve factors according to validated and applicable Airbus methods & sizing processes.

Proven ability to provide stress analyses for the repair/acceptance of Metal and/or Composite / Hybrids damaged structures.

Ability to write and interpret Python scripts for diverse tasks, including data manipulation and automation.
